Robert Downey Jr. Reportedly Returning For Multiple Marvel Projects


Casting or character comeback rumors are regularly part of every Marvel fan's life. Given their longing to always have their favorite stars on the screen, fans are always in the position to believe any hearsay or hope that they will turn out to be true. Robert Downey Jr., who’s known for his role as Tony Stark, aka Iron Man, has yet to be seen again on the big screen. With his long-awaited return, the Sherlock Holmes star is reportedly returning for multiple MCU projects.

Downey Jr.'s Iron Man died in Avengers: Endgame, but with Marvel's time travel and multiple universes, there's always a way for the fan favorite superhero to return, despite the actor's previous statements to the contrary. “To me, starting up again is off the table. I feel like I’ve done all I could with that character,” he once said. “There would have to be a super compelling argument and a series of events that made it obvious. But the other thing is, I wanna do other stuff.”

However, Twitter-based industry insider @MyTimeToShineH recently gave the fans something to hold onto concerning Iron Man’s return. He wrote, “RDJ is back, baby (for Secret Wars for sure, and there's been some talks for a cameo in Armor Wars).” Other scoopers have backed the rumor, including Ember, who wrote: “I can corroborate the RDJ thing.” Check the tweet below:

Downey Jr. could make a return to the MCU with the 2026 film Secret Wars. The character may not have a future in the MCU after that, and the reappearance is expected to be just a cameo. According to reports, the movie may include a pre-recorded Tony Stark statement, similar to the one that ended Avengers: Endgame.

Whether the MCU star returns as Tony Stark in full armor, through a hologram, or in a flashback, fans would be delighted to receive it. Downey Jr. is one of the pillars of Marvel, and only he can play Iron Man. Despite being 42 months away, Secret Wars is expected to be the biggest movie of the franchise.
